Oatmeal Carrot Cookies

Serves: 2 dozen
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- ½ tsp salt
- ½ tsp baking soda
- 1¼ cup rolled oats, not instant
- ½ cup raisins
- 1 cup finely shredded/grated carrots
- 1 TBSP orange zest
- 6 TBSP butter, softened
- ½ cup sugar
- ½ cup dark brown sugar
- 1 tsp vanilla
- 1 egg
- Preheat 350° F.
- In small bowl, combine oats, raisins, carrots, and orange zest. Set aside.
- In small bowl, combine flour, salt, and baking soda. Set aside.
- In a medium-sized bowl (or standing mixer bowl) combine sugar and butter and beat until creamy smooth.
- Add extract and egg and beat until well-blended.
- Add in flour mixture and stir until well-combined.
- Add oat mixture and stir until all ingredients are thoroughly combined.
- Using teaspoon or a small ice cream scoop, drop balls of dough onto ungreased cookie sheet. (We used nonstick foil.)
- Bake 9-10 minutes or until cookies turn pale golden brown.
- Cool completely.
